Check
and Double Check Your Website Functionality
We live in a world of ever-changing technology,
and some of these changes can adversely impact your website.
Here are some steps you can take to ensure your website continues
to function correctly and stays accessible to clients and
visitors.
New Browser Updates May Cause Problems
When Internet Explorer released version
7, some website navigation systems stopped working. Now would
be a good time to make sure your website navigation is working
correctly in IE 7 by either updating to that version or finding
a computer that's using it. Check with friends or visit your
local Circuit City or Best Buy to monitor your website on
both PCs and Macs.
Web Host Security Upgrades May Cause
Problems
Good web hosting companies update and install
security upgrades to protect or enhance email performance.
However, some of these upgrades may effect how your web forms
work. A form script installed in your website in 2005 may
not function with a web mail server upgrade installed in 2008.
Check your web
forms. If you have one or more website forms, fill
them out and click submit. Then check your email to see if
you received the information. If not, contact your web host
or web developer to trouble-shoot and correct the problem.
It is critical that your web forms are working since this
is one of your gateways to your electronic communication.
Check for Broken Links
Nothing will frustrate a visitor more
than a broken link. Plus, this makes your website look bad.
It tells your visitor you really don’t care or pay much
attention to your website. Check your email links too.
If you have over 50 links to outside websites you may want
to subscribe to a link checking service to detect changed
or broken links. Working links are good for your search engine
ranking. However, if a search engine robot is constantly detecting
multiple broken links, developers agree this may affect your
ranking.
